How to Clean a Starkey Hearing Aid
Things You'll Need
- Paper towel
- Cotton swab
- Clean toothbrush
- Soft cloth (that came with the hearing aid)
Instructions
-
-
1
Remove the Starkey hearing aid from your ear and place it on a paper towel.
-
2
Turn the hearing aid over and remove the battery cover. Take out the battery and lay it on the paper towel.
-
3
Use a cotton swab and gently clean the battery contacts. Take care not to break or bend the battery contacts.
-
4
Reinstall the battery in the hearing aid. Place the battery cover back in place.
-
5
Use a clean toothbrush to gently scrub the hearing aid to break up any caked-on earwax and grime. Scrub around the microphone and receiver.
-
6
Wipe the Starkey hearing aid with the soft cloth that came with the hearing aid. Do not wet the cloth and do not use any liquid on the device.
